How much does it cost to rent a home in Lennox?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lennox 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,928 | $2,095 | $4,500 |
| Lennox 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,138 | $2,950 | $6,200 |
| Lennox 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,885 | $3,995 | $9,500 |
| Lennox 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,900 | $6,900 | $6,900 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Lennox
What type of rentals are currently available in Lennox?
There are currently 3064 Apartments for Rent in Lennox, CA with pricing that ranges from $1,162 to $5,279. There are also 147 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Lennox ranging from $1,179 to $9,500.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Lennox?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Lennox ranges from $1,179 to $9,500 with an average monthly rent of $3,951.
